A monsoon is:
A type of bird.
A long period of heavy rain.
A type of dance.
A bright light in the sky.
Answer explanation
A monsoon refers to a seasonal wind pattern that brings a long period of heavy rain, particularly in South Asia. It is not a bird, dance, or light, making 'a long period of heavy rain' the correct choice.

If someone hurled an object, they:
Gently placed it down.
Hit it with their hand.
Threw it with great force.
Kicked it softly.
Answer explanation
To hurl an object means to throw it with great force. The other options, such as gently placing it down or kicking it softly, do not convey the same intensity or action as hurling.

When someone tousles your hair, they:
Brush it neatly.
Smooth it with their hands.
Mess it up playfully.
Cut it very short.
Answer explanation
When someone tousles your hair, they are playfully messing it up, which is a lighthearted action. This contrasts with brushing it neatly or smoothing it, which imply tidiness, and cutting it short, which is a drastic change.
